- RIPE NCC Launches IPv6 Implementation Guide
-
With just over 10% of IPv4 address space left, the RIPE NCC launches How to Act Now - a guide to making IPv6 deployment simple. The first ever resource of its kind, How to Act Now provides large and small business and government users with the information necessary to successfully deploy IPv6 in their networks.

- RIPE NCC Meeting in Moscow Hailed as a Unique Forum by Regional Internet Experts
-
Representatives from regional network operators, telecommunications organisations, vendors, local government and the media gathered in Moscow for the RIPE NCC Regional Meeting. More than 200 attendees participated in the two-day event, which provided a unique opportunity to discuss the latest developments affecting the Internet in the Russian region.
